IMP Awards / Intl > Japan > 2009 Movie Poster Gallery / Mega Monster Battle: Ultra Galaxy Legends - The Movie Poster
other sizes: 1070x1500 Poster design by Yoshiki Takahashi
Want to buy the poster? Try these links: